Best 30224 Georgia Private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 private schools serving 118 students in 30224, GA (there are 8 public schools, serving 5,562 public students). 2% of all K-12 students in 30224, GA are educated in private schools (compared to the GA state average of 8%).
100% of private schools in 30224, GA are religiously affiliated (most commonly Christian and Baptist).
